HANOI (Vietnam news/ANN): Science and technology, which has played a significant role in promoting socioeconomic development, is also the motivation and key for Vietnam to complete the net-zero emission commitment by 2050, which was given by Prime Minister Pham Minh Chinh at the 26th UN Climate Change Conference (COP26), according to experts.
Nguyen Tien Tai, Vice Director of the Department of Science and Technology for Economic Technical Branches under the Ministry of Science and Technology, said that recognising the significance of science-technology as the key for national socioeconomic development, the Prime Minister has issued a Decision approving a national strategy on science, technology and innovation promotion until 2030.
